AN ANTINOMIAN DAWN

“If then the light in you is darkness,how great is the darkness” (Mt. 6:22b)!

The sun declines from West to East

And darkness rules the day.

Thick Darkness stalks through waking hours

And night’s light turns to gray.

For moonlight, moon dust all around,

The stars’ light fades away.

And darkened sense now cannot see

Morality’s decay.

12 April, 2013

ECCLESIASTES REDUX

“Vanity of vanities, saith the Preacher,Vanity of vanities; all is vanity” (Eccl. 1:2, KJV).

“…What profit hath he that hath labored for the wind” (Eccl. 5:16, KJV).

The abandoned pulpit echoes

(vanity of vanities)

A laboring for wind,

Some human suspiration

To give voice to a word,

A pacemaker of grace perhaps,

To strengthen the iambic

Of an old man’s tired heart.

6 October, 2012
